Four novel metal-organic frameworks, [Cu(Tmp)(2)(H2O)] center dot NO3 (I) (Tmp = 3,4,7,8-tetramethyl-1,10-phenanthroline), [Mn(Tmp)(2)(H2O)(2)] center dot 2NO(3) center dot H2O (II), [Pb(Tmp)(CH3COO)(2)] center dot 3H(2)O (III) and [Zn(Tmp)(2)(H2O)(2)] center dot 2NO(3) center dot 2H(2)O (IV), have been synthesized and characterized by single crystal X-ray diffraction (CIF files CCDC nos. 88362-88365 for I-IV, respectively), IR spectroscopy, elemental analysis and thermogravimetric analysis. Both I and II complexes are crystallized in monoclinic system with space groups C2/c, P2(1)/c, respectively, while III and IV complexes are crystallized in triclinic system with space groups . Generally, these crystal structures are stabilized by O-H center dot center dot center dot O hydrogen bonds and pi-pi interactions between the phenanthroline rings of neighboring molecules. Thermogravimetric analyses of compounds I-IV display considerable thermal stability.
